Harvey Nash Plc
Newcastle Upon Tyne, Tyne And Wear
Senior Software Developer Are you passionate about test driven development and working on a vast range of innovative technology? We are currently looking for a number of software developers with a variety of different skill sets to join our client whilst they experience a period of exciting growth. This role gives an exciting opportunity for passionate developers to get involved with some innovative greenfield projects, working as part of a collaborative, cross-functional and agile team. What you will be doing: As a Senior Software Developer, you will contribute to the development of innovative digital products in order to enhance customer experiences. You will develop and maintain high-quality, scalable code across diverse digital platforms. You will be responsible for collaborating closely with interdisciplinary teams within an agile framework. You will be working in an agile product focused team. You will uphold best practices in CI/CD, cloud platforms, and cybersecurity. You will promote the importance of clean, testable code and continuous enhancement. Who you will be: You will demonstrate a proven track record of developing clean, testable and maintainable code working with C#, .NET and Object-Oriented design. Ideally you will have experience working on mobile development, whether this be IOS, Flutter or Android. You will have a strong background of working with RESTful APIs. It is essential that you possess a proactive attitude with the ability to foster productive relationships with stakeholders and the wider team. You will have experience working with modern microservice architecture. You will have a strong understanding of working with Docker and Kubernetes. If you are interested, please get in touch with me to schedule a call and we can discuss further!
22/04/2024
Full time
Senior Software Developer Are you passionate about test driven development and working on a vast range of innovative technology? We are currently looking for a number of software developers with a variety of different skill sets to join our client whilst they experience a period of exciting growth. This role gives an exciting opportunity for passionate developers to get involved with some innovative greenfield projects, working as part of a collaborative, cross-functional and agile team. What you will be doing: As a Senior Software Developer, you will contribute to the development of innovative digital products in order to enhance customer experiences. You will develop and maintain high-quality, scalable code across diverse digital platforms. You will be responsible for collaborating closely with interdisciplinary teams within an agile framework. You will be working in an agile product focused team. You will uphold best practices in CI/CD, cloud platforms, and cybersecurity. You will promote the importance of clean, testable code and continuous enhancement. Who you will be: You will demonstrate a proven track record of developing clean, testable and maintainable code working with C#, .NET and Object-Oriented design. Ideally you will have experience working on mobile development, whether this be IOS, Flutter or Android. You will have a strong background of working with RESTful APIs. It is essential that you possess a proactive attitude with the ability to foster productive relationships with stakeholders and the wider team. You will have experience working with modern microservice architecture. You will have a strong understanding of working with Docker and Kubernetes. If you are interested, please get in touch with me to schedule a call and we can discuss further!
Computer Futures - London & S.E(Permanent and Contract)
Newcastle Upon Tyne, Tyne And Wear
I'm currently recruiting for an Embedded Software Engineer on behalf of one of my customers in the North East of England. The C++ Embedded Software Engineer will help my customer develop software used in the medical industry. Embedded Software Engineer 3 days remote and 2 days on site Newcastle Key Roles and Responsibilities Developing C++/Linux based applications designed to run on Embedded Devices. Working alongside the technical Lead to assist with architectural design. Lead development sub-projects when needed. Collaborate with other teams/disciplines such as Engineering or Electronics where required. Collaborate and perform peer code reviews. Work with the Software Team Lead, and Software Platform Technical Lead to encourage and foster a culture of code quality within the software team. Key skills Strong C++ development experience Version control, git and good OO skills Embedded Linux application development, for example: Cross compiling, remote debugging g. QML/Qt UI development Embedded Linux OS development, eg Yocto and Buildroot Proven full life cycle capabilities, in particular: design, build, test and maintenance of Embedded software Experience with 'unit' testing in Embedded software Computer Futures, a trading division of SThree Partnership LLP is acting as an Employment Agency in relation to this vacancy
18/04/2024
Full time
I'm currently recruiting for an Embedded Software Engineer on behalf of one of my customers in the North East of England. The C++ Embedded Software Engineer will help my customer develop software used in the medical industry. Embedded Software Engineer 3 days remote and 2 days on site Newcastle Key Roles and Responsibilities Developing C++/Linux based applications designed to run on Embedded Devices. Working alongside the technical Lead to assist with architectural design. Lead development sub-projects when needed. Collaborate with other teams/disciplines such as Engineering or Electronics where required. Collaborate and perform peer code reviews. Work with the Software Team Lead, and Software Platform Technical Lead to encourage and foster a culture of code quality within the software team. Key skills Strong C++ development experience Version control, git and good OO skills Embedded Linux application development, for example: Cross compiling, remote debugging g. QML/Qt UI development Embedded Linux OS development, eg Yocto and Buildroot Proven full life cycle capabilities, in particular: design, build, test and maintenance of Embedded software Experience with 'unit' testing in Embedded software Computer Futures, a trading division of SThree Partnership LLP is acting as an Employment Agency in relation to this vacancy
Reed Technology
Newcastle Upon Tyne, Tyne And Wear
The Company This company are a global organisation with offices worldwide and a clear strategy to develop and grow their employees internally. This business recognises that expansion is meaningful only when it is underpinned by truly global collaboration. We foster an environment where pioneering work thrives, allowing our people to move and think beyond boundaries. In addition to relevant skills and experience, we seek individuals who are innovative, commercially savvy, and deeply value-driven. The Role As the direct report to the Service Desk Lead, this position demands a proactive, organized, and self-motivated individual. Strong written and verbal communication skills are essential, as the role involves interacting with business and internal IT stakeholders across all levels. Another important aspect of this role is performance management and the ability to maintain and improve employees' performance in line with the organisation's objectives. The successful candidate will have experience of some of the following. The below list isn't exhaustive, it's more to provide an idea. If you're meeting a handful of the required points, we'd still encourage you to apply: Experience within a similar role Proven track record in team supervision, workload prioritization, and resource management. Some exposure to ITIL Problem and Change disciplines. Workload Management: Ability to handle personal and team workloads, including managing team rotas. Performance Measurement: Proficient in measuring and monitoring team operational performance through agreed KPIs, providing management reports to the Service Desk Manager or Customer Services Manager. Working knowledge of M365 and Azure Benefits include: Excellent pension Scheme Training and progression plans Flexible working Private Healthcare Life Assurance Local Discounts International Opportunities Holiday Buy and Sell And more! Hybrid working/2 days per week in office/Newcastle City Centre You must be fully eligible to work in the UK and be able to travel into the office on occasion
17/04/2024
Full time
The Company This company are a global organisation with offices worldwide and a clear strategy to develop and grow their employees internally. This business recognises that expansion is meaningful only when it is underpinned by truly global collaboration. We foster an environment where pioneering work thrives, allowing our people to move and think beyond boundaries. In addition to relevant skills and experience, we seek individuals who are innovative, commercially savvy, and deeply value-driven. The Role As the direct report to the Service Desk Lead, this position demands a proactive, organized, and self-motivated individual. Strong written and verbal communication skills are essential, as the role involves interacting with business and internal IT stakeholders across all levels. Another important aspect of this role is performance management and the ability to maintain and improve employees' performance in line with the organisation's objectives. The successful candidate will have experience of some of the following. The below list isn't exhaustive, it's more to provide an idea. If you're meeting a handful of the required points, we'd still encourage you to apply: Experience within a similar role Proven track record in team supervision, workload prioritization, and resource management. Some exposure to ITIL Problem and Change disciplines. Workload Management: Ability to handle personal and team workloads, including managing team rotas. Performance Measurement: Proficient in measuring and monitoring team operational performance through agreed KPIs, providing management reports to the Service Desk Manager or Customer Services Manager. Working knowledge of M365 and Azure Benefits include: Excellent pension Scheme Training and progression plans Flexible working Private Healthcare Life Assurance Local Discounts International Opportunities Holiday Buy and Sell And more! Hybrid working/2 days per week in office/Newcastle City Centre You must be fully eligible to work in the UK and be able to travel into the office on occasion
Xpertise is seeking two talented Machine Learning Engineers to join our esteemed team in Birmingham. As part of our growing engineering division, you will play a pivotal role in designing, implementing, and optimizing machine learning models and data pipelines. With a strong emphasis on AWS technologies and MLOps practices, you'll have the opportunity to contribute to the development of scalable, production-grade solutions that drive business value. Key details: Salary: £55,000-95,000 (Mid-Lead) I'd consider experienced contractors with a rate of £400.00 per day (Outisde IR35) Benefits: 10-25% bonus + healthcare + 10% pension Location: Newcastle or Birmingham; can be remote-based, hybrid working or office-based Key experience desired/what you will learn: Experience developing, deploying, and maintaining machine learning models in production environments. Strong understanding of AWS cloud services, especially in building and managing data pipelines and machine learning workflows: S3, Redshift, Lambda, Glue, EMR, EKS (Kubernetes) Familiarity with MLOps/DevOps concepts and practices, including version control, CI/CD, and model monitoring. Proficiency in Python and relevant data manipulation and analysis libraries (eg, pandas, NumPy). Experience with distributed computing frameworks like Apache Spark is a plus. Apache Spark and Airflow would be a bonus. Role overview: If you're looking to work with a team of ambitious software engineers, talented senior leaders all while working with the latest data, AI and cloud technologies, then this one's for you. They have big plans to disrupt the industry with this machine learning work, so it's a great time to join. Interested? Please apply with your CV and/or message Billy Hall for further details. Xpertise acts as an employment agency.
17/04/2024
Full time
Xpertise is seeking two talented Machine Learning Engineers to join our esteemed team in Birmingham. As part of our growing engineering division, you will play a pivotal role in designing, implementing, and optimizing machine learning models and data pipelines. With a strong emphasis on AWS technologies and MLOps practices, you'll have the opportunity to contribute to the development of scalable, production-grade solutions that drive business value. Key details: Salary: £55,000-95,000 (Mid-Lead) I'd consider experienced contractors with a rate of £400.00 per day (Outisde IR35) Benefits: 10-25% bonus + healthcare + 10% pension Location: Newcastle or Birmingham; can be remote-based, hybrid working or office-based Key experience desired/what you will learn: Experience developing, deploying, and maintaining machine learning models in production environments. Strong understanding of AWS cloud services, especially in building and managing data pipelines and machine learning workflows: S3, Redshift, Lambda, Glue, EMR, EKS (Kubernetes) Familiarity with MLOps/DevOps concepts and practices, including version control, CI/CD, and model monitoring. Proficiency in Python and relevant data manipulation and analysis libraries (eg, pandas, NumPy). Experience with distributed computing frameworks like Apache Spark is a plus. Apache Spark and Airflow would be a bonus. Role overview: If you're looking to work with a team of ambitious software engineers, talented senior leaders all while working with the latest data, AI and cloud technologies, then this one's for you. They have big plans to disrupt the industry with this machine learning work, so it's a great time to join. Interested? Please apply with your CV and/or message Billy Hall for further details. Xpertise acts as an employment agency.
Salary: £60k Job Type: Contract (6 month initial - with the option to extend) Job Location: Newcastle Workplace Type: Hybrid (3 days in office) Seeking a highly skilled and innovative full-stack Software Engineer with a minimum of 4 years of hands-on experience in the Software Development field. The ideal candidate will have a proven track record of working autonomously and must be proficient in a wide range of programming languages. As a Software Engineer, you will be instrumental in the development and deployment of state-of-the-art software solutions. You will work with cutting-edge technologies, contribute to the full software development life cycle, and collaborate with cross-functional teams. Key responsibilities: Develop serverless applications using AWS Lambda, API Gateway, and other AWS services. Leverage AWS infrastructure to build scalable and reliable software solutions. Experience with cloud computing platforms, particularly Azure, is desirable Full-stack Java, JavaScript (Typescript) for full-stack JavaScript development. Implement efficient and maintainable code for both Front End and Back End components. Knowledge of implementing and maintaining CI/CD pipelines Implement Test Driven Development (TDD) and Behaviour Driven Development (BDD) Conduct browser testing with Cypress & Browser Stack. Perform accessibility testing using AXE. Utilise Grafana for Load/Stress/Break testing. Proficiency in SQL and noSQL databases, including but not limited to Postgres, MySQL, and MongoDB, is preferred. Familiarity and expertise in APIs, RESTful services, and Microservice Architectures are desired qualifications Design and implement web front ends using ReactJS, with a focus on Next.js for enhanced performance. Manage code and versioning using GitHub. Skills and experience: Hands-on experience with the mentioned technologies and tools. Proven track record of successful software development projects with a minimum of 4 years of hands-on experience. Proficiency in full-stack Java, JavaScript and Typescript. Experience with AWS, Azure, Serverless Technologies, ReactJS, and Next.js. Strong understanding of Infrastructure as Code (IaC) principles. Familiarity with TDD and BDD. Excellent communication skills, both written and verbal. Ability to collaborate effectively in a multi-functional Agile delivery team Accountable for maintaining the operational stability of developed products and having the capability to influence continuous enhancements in their robustness and resilience About FDM Our people are our passion and that's why we make your training and career growth our priority. We are a global professional services provider focusing on IT and one of the UK's leading graduate employers, recruiting the brightest talent to become the innovators of tomorrow. With centres across Europe, North America and Asia-Pacific, and nearly 5000 consultants currently placed on client site around the world, FDM has shown exponential growth throughout the years, firmly establishing itself as an award-winning FTSE 250 employer. Diversity and Inclusion FDM Group is an Equal Opportunity Employer, and all qualified applicants will receive consideration for employment without regard to race, colour, religion, sex, sexual orientation, national origin, age, disability, veteran status or any other status protected by federal, provincial or local laws.
17/04/2024
Project-based
Salary: £60k Job Type: Contract (6 month initial - with the option to extend) Job Location: Newcastle Workplace Type: Hybrid (3 days in office) Seeking a highly skilled and innovative full-stack Software Engineer with a minimum of 4 years of hands-on experience in the Software Development field. The ideal candidate will have a proven track record of working autonomously and must be proficient in a wide range of programming languages. As a Software Engineer, you will be instrumental in the development and deployment of state-of-the-art software solutions. You will work with cutting-edge technologies, contribute to the full software development life cycle, and collaborate with cross-functional teams. Key responsibilities: Develop serverless applications using AWS Lambda, API Gateway, and other AWS services. Leverage AWS infrastructure to build scalable and reliable software solutions. Experience with cloud computing platforms, particularly Azure, is desirable Full-stack Java, JavaScript (Typescript) for full-stack JavaScript development. Implement efficient and maintainable code for both Front End and Back End components. Knowledge of implementing and maintaining CI/CD pipelines Implement Test Driven Development (TDD) and Behaviour Driven Development (BDD) Conduct browser testing with Cypress & Browser Stack. Perform accessibility testing using AXE. Utilise Grafana for Load/Stress/Break testing. Proficiency in SQL and noSQL databases, including but not limited to Postgres, MySQL, and MongoDB, is preferred. Familiarity and expertise in APIs, RESTful services, and Microservice Architectures are desired qualifications Design and implement web front ends using ReactJS, with a focus on Next.js for enhanced performance. Manage code and versioning using GitHub. Skills and experience: Hands-on experience with the mentioned technologies and tools. Proven track record of successful software development projects with a minimum of 4 years of hands-on experience. Proficiency in full-stack Java, JavaScript and Typescript. Experience with AWS, Azure, Serverless Technologies, ReactJS, and Next.js. Strong understanding of Infrastructure as Code (IaC) principles. Familiarity with TDD and BDD. Excellent communication skills, both written and verbal. Ability to collaborate effectively in a multi-functional Agile delivery team Accountable for maintaining the operational stability of developed products and having the capability to influence continuous enhancements in their robustness and resilience About FDM Our people are our passion and that's why we make your training and career growth our priority. We are a global professional services provider focusing on IT and one of the UK's leading graduate employers, recruiting the brightest talent to become the innovators of tomorrow. With centres across Europe, North America and Asia-Pacific, and nearly 5000 consultants currently placed on client site around the world, FDM has shown exponential growth throughout the years, firmly establishing itself as an award-winning FTSE 250 employer. Diversity and Inclusion FDM Group is an Equal Opportunity Employer, and all qualified applicants will receive consideration for employment without regard to race, colour, religion, sex, sexual orientation, national origin, age, disability, veteran status or any other status protected by federal, provincial or local laws.